10 Essential Herbs you can grow in a home garden

Essential herbs for indoor gardeningHaving a home garden with herbs is a great idea, especially to make instant home remedies. While most essential herbs do not take a vast amount of space, they can be easily a part of a home garden. Let us take a look at the top ten herbs that one can grow in homes.

Basil: Basil is also commonly known as Tulsi, a common herb grown in every Hindu home. Not only do basil leaves give a warm and spicy flavor to the meals, it is also known for its anti-inflammatory properties helping in coughs and common cold. Tulsi plant is also considered as the holiest according to Hindu mythology.

Coriander: Coriander, also known as dhaniya, is an essential ingredient for most Indian and some western cuisines. Coriander leaves can be dried and crushed into a powder form or used directly. Home grown coriander leaves can double up as a beautification plant in the home garden while offering its exotic gourmet delights.

Fennel: Fennel also known as Saunf is a multipurpose herb that can be grown in the home garden. Fennel seeds are part of many ayurvedic and natural remedies. Water boiled with fennel seeds is a healthy drink aiding digestion.

Recommended herbs for your home garden.Mint: Mint or peppermint is an essential ingredient in various cuisines and home remedies. Mint comes in a number of varieties including Japan mint, spear mint and wild mint. Autumn and spring are the best seasons to plant a mint plant in the garden. Mint is a natural mouth fresher and chewing mint leaves aids digestion.

Parsley: Commonly known as Ajmood in Hindi, Parsley leaves are popularly used in Mediterranean cooking. Parsley can be grown in a house garden and requires an ideal temperature setting between 20 to 25 degrees. For the Indian summer, Parsley plant can be planted in a pot that can be moved to cooler areas.

Lemon Grass: Lemon grass or Cymbopogon is an essential herb used widely in Thai and Chinese cooking. It requires ample sunshine to bloom. Lemon grass has a citrus flavor and the stems are dried and powdered to be used in various home remedies and cooking.

Sage: Commonly known as salvis, “sefakuss” in Hindi and “neelamulli” in Tamil. This is a popular herb that can be easily planted in the home garden. Sage leaves have anti bacterial and anti fungal properties making them a useful constituent of various home remedies.

Curry Patta: Curry patta or curry leaves are an important ingredient in South Indian cuisines. Curry leaves not only makes food aromatic, but have several medicinal properties. It can be easily grown in pots.

Garlic: Garlic is an essential herb with multiple uses that can grow in a home garden easily. From being useful as a vital ingredient in healthy living, and tasty cooking, garlic also aiding in recovery from common colds and fever.

Aloe Vera: Aloe Vera is one of the easiest plants to have in a home garden. With its vast medicinal and therapeutic properties, the Aloe Vera gel in raw form is useful in skin care and hair care.
